Particle
In IGCSE sciences, particle is the universal term describing the tiny individual constituents of matter 1. Depending on the substance, a particle may be:
- An Atom: The smallest individual unit of an element (e.g., helium, iron).
- A Molecule: Two or more non-metal atoms chemically bonded together (e.g., , ).
- An Ion: An atom or group of atoms that has gained or lost electrons, acquiring an electrical charge (e.g., , ).

Role in Kinetic Particle Theory
According to Kinetic Particle Theory, the physical state and bulk behavior of any substance depend on three key particle features 1 2:
- Arrangement: Regular ordered pattern or random disorder.
- Separation: Tightly packed in contact or separated by large empty spaces.
- Motion & Kinetic Energy: Vibrating about fixed positions or moving freely at speeds proportional to temperature.
